Roc-A-Fella Records: A Hip-Hop Empire

One of his first big moves was co-founding Roc-A-Fella Records in 1995 with Damon Dash and Kareem "Biggs" Burke. This label, very quickly, became a powerhouse in hip-hop. It was the home for his own music and helped launch the careers of other big artists. Selling his stake in Roc-A-Fella was a smart financial play, too, a really significant one.

This early venture showed his business smarts beyond just making music. He understood the value of owning the means of production, so to speak. It was a clear sign of his ambition and his understanding of how the industry worked, or how it could work better, that is.

Armand de Brignac (Ace of Spades): Luxury Spirits

Jay-Z's involvement with Armand de Brignac, the luxury champagne known as Ace of Spades, is a prime example of his smart investments. He initially had a stake in the brand, and then, in 2014, he acquired full ownership. This move, honestly, was a brilliant one for his portfolio.

In 2021, he sold a 50% stake in Armand de Brignac to LVMH, a major luxury goods company, for an undisclosed sum. This deal, you know, not only brought in a huge amount of cash but also showed his ability to grow a brand and then make a very profitable exit or partnership. It's a clear indicator of his business savvy.

D'USSÉ Cognac: Another Spirited Success

His interest in spirits didn't stop with champagne. Jay-Z also co-owns D'USSÉ Cognac with Bacardi. This venture has also seen considerable success, further diversifying his income streams. It's another instance where he's put his name and business sense behind a high-end product, and it's worked out very well.

The success of D'USSÉ, like Ace of Spades, shows his understanding of the luxury market and how to connect with consumers who appreciate fine things. He clearly has a good feel for what people want, especially in that premium space, you know?

Tidal: A Streaming Service Bet

In 2015, Jay-Z acquired the music streaming service Tidal for $56 million. His vision was to create a platform that offered higher-quality audio and better artist compensation. While it faced some initial challenges, he later sold a majority stake in Tidal to Square (now Block Inc.) for nearly $300 million in 2021. This was, by all accounts, a very solid return on his original investment.

This move, very simply, showed his willingness to take calculated risks in the tech space. He saw potential in a challenging market and managed to turn it into a significant win. It's a good example of his forward-thinking approach to business, that is.

Other Key Investments and Ventures

Beyond these major ventures, Jay-Z has a wide range of other investments. He was an early investor in Uber, which turned into a very valuable stake. His portfolio also includes significant real estate holdings, art collections, and various other private equity investments. He's pretty much everywhere, in a good way.

These diverse investments show that he doesn't put all his eggs in one basket. He spreads his wealth across different sectors, which is a smart way to build a lasting fortune. This strategy, you know, helps protect his assets and grow them over time.
